How they compare
Latvia currently reports 12.9 against 9.8 in Slovenia, a difference of 3.1.
That makes Latvia's figure about 1.3 times Slovenia's.
The two have swapped places 7 times across 25 shared years of data; in 2001 it was Slovenia ahead.
Latvia ranks 5th and Slovenia ranks 7th of 31 countries.
Latvia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
